In a thrilling episode of The Masked Singer, the identity of the mysterious Gargoyle was finally revealed, and it sparked a wave of nostalgia for music enthusiasts. But here's where it gets intriguing: the Gargoyle turned out to be none other than Marcella Detroit, the iconic voice behind Shakespears Sister, a band that defined the 80s pop scene.

Marcella Detroit, a multi-talented artist, rose to fame as the dynamic force behind Shakespears Sister, alongside former Bananarama member Siobhan Fahey. Their collaboration created an unforgettable sound that left an indelible mark on the music industry. But Detroit's musical prowess extends beyond her time with the band. Did you know she co-wrote the iconic Eric Clapton hit, "Lay Down Sally"? It's a testament to her incredible songwriting skills.

On Saturday night's show, the Gargoyle took center stage and delivered a powerful performance of Joan Jett's "Bad Reputation." The judges were left in awe, and the audience was buzzing with excitement. But this is the part most people miss: Detroit's journey as a solo artist is just as remarkable. She released her debut solo album, "Marcella," in 1982, showcasing her unique talent and versatility.
